build: fix "warning: "_FORTIFY_SOURCE" redefined" (#6283)
The warning is being produced on Arch since pacman 6.1, which changed
`-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2` to `-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=3` in CFLAGS in
makepkg.conf:
$ pacman -Q gcc pacman
gcc 13.2.1-5
pacman 6.1.0-3
$ makepkg
[...]
make -C src/lib
gcc [...] -D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2 [...] -Wp,-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=3 [...] -c ../../src/lib/common.c -o ../../src/lib/common.o
<command-line>: warning: "_FORTIFY_SOURCE" redefined
<command-line>: note: this is the location of the previous definition
To fix this, only add `-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E` to EXTRA_CFLAGS if it does not
cause any warnings with CFLAGS and CPPFLAGS during compilation.
The effect remains the same: The build system still defines the macro by
default (if there are no warnings) and the user/distribution can still
override it through CFLAGS/CPPFLAGS.
Fixes #6282.
